SAN DIEGO – San Diego begins a six-game homestand this weekend when it plays host to Cal State Bakersfield on Saturday and Sunday.
Â
The Toreros (9-14) will open the three-game series against the Roadrunners (7-10) with a double-header on Saturday beginning at noon. The series concludes Sunday at noon.
Â
USD went 2-2 last weekend at the Highlander Classic at UC Riverside. The Toreros opened the tournament with a pair of wins against Omaha. USD dropped tough back-to-back one-run decisions against Houston and UC Riverside to conclude the weekend.
Â
Cal State Bakersfield enters the weekend on a three-game losing streak.
Â
Sara Silveyra leads the Toreros with a .400 batting average, followed by
Taylor Spence (.393) and
Lindsay Clare (.333). The trio have started all 20 games this season, along with freshman
Kelli Kufta.
Â
Silveyra has produced a team-high 12 RBIs, while
Madison Casiano and
Shelbi Evans have contributed 10 apiece.
Â
Madison Earnshaw and
Delaney Heller have contributed a majority of the innings in the circle at 44 2/3 and 42 1/3, respectively.
